How do you prototype? by jard-389 in gamedev

[–]koarabbit 6 points7 points  (0 children)

When prototyping a game idea, I set a time limit for implementation. Instead of aiming to finish the idea as quickly as possible, I focus on implementing as much of it as possible within this timeframe. Therefore, it's inevitable to overlook some details, but that's okay since the prototype should be disposable. This method has saved me significant time and enabled me to evaluate multiple ideas effectively.

Hello fellow gamedevs, I want to make games but… by [deleted] in gamedev

[–]koarabbit 5 points6 points  (0 children)

If coding isn't your preference, I highly recommend Unreal. Its visual coding feature, known as Blueprints, enables you to implement most functionalities without needing to write a single line of code.
